Summary
Sung Nam is a seasoned technology leader and educator, currently serving as a Senior Instructor at the University of Colorado Denver with a career rooted in telecom software and systems. He brings deep domain expertise in data mining and modeling, business intelligence, SIP/H.323 signaling, and core networking, underpinned by strong Java and IP/TCP-IP skills. In industry roles at Avaya and Lucent, he led architectural design, remote product connectivity initiatives, and BI platform modernization, including guiding offshore teams through complex migrations. Since 2019 he has been translating this experience into the classroom, teaching Unix systems programming, algorithms, data structures, object-oriented programming, and logic design. He holds an MS in Computer Science from the University of Colorado Boulder and a BA in Computer Science from the University of Colorado Colorado Springs.
